Romania

The Danube Delta, is one of Europe’s most isolated and inaccessible regions and is one of Europe’s richest location for birds. The world’s largest reed-beds tuck in a tangled web of channels. Guided boat tours with knowledgeable bird experts make the exploration fascinating. The remarkable painted monasteries of Southern Bucovina are one of the finest examples of Byzantine art in Europe. The astonishing frescoes on the outside and inside walls still burst with color and vitality. Campgrounds are safe and are gradually being upgraded. Gates are closed in the evening and security persons are often on duty throughout the day and night. Outside the cities and larger towns traffic is light.
